In his speech at the company’s AGM, Alliance Aviation Services chair James Jackson said the charter, FIFO and wet-lease operator has been looking “to review and seek to renegotiate a major ACMI [aircraft, crew, maintenance and insurance] contract” due to unexpected high costs.
